    CONMAT CSLM 2500 vs Tarle SLM 2200: Which to Buy?

    The CONMAT CSLM 2500 and the Tarle SLM 2200 are both self loading concrete mixers built with different priorities. The CONMAT CSLM 2500 uses 4-wheel steering with three modes, joystick control and a bigger fuel tank for less frequent refueling. The Tarle SLM 2200 carries a bigger drum, climbs steeper slopes and holds more water for mixing.

    A contractor who needs precise, easy handling in a crowded site will value the CONMAT CSLM 2500's steering and joystick control. A buyer working on sloped ground who needs more concrete per load and a bigger water supply will get more from the Tarle SLM 2200.     Tarle SLM 2200 Vs CONMAT CSLM 2500 Self Loading Specifications

    Engine

    Tarle SLM 2200 CONMAT CSLM 2500
    Engine Make KOEL KOEL 4R810T
    Engine Type BS-IV / CEV Stage IV compliant; CRDI BS-V Diesel Engine 4 Cylinder Turbocharged; Water Cooled
    Max. Power 49.5 HP (36.9 kW) @ 2200 RPM 49 HP (36.5 kW) @ 2200 RPM

    Drive & Control

    Tarle SLM 2200 CONMAT CSLM 2500
    Transmission Type 4WD with 4‑wheel mechanical transmission 4-Wheel Drive Hydrostatic Transmission
    Steering Type Manual mechanical 4‑wheel steering; 3 selectable modes
    Drive Type 4 Wheel Drive 4 Wheel Drive
    Brake Fully-enclosed oil-bath disc brakes Hydraulic powered brakes
    Max. Speed 23 km/h 22 km/h
    Gradeability 23° 20°

    Mixer

    Tarle SLM 2200 CONMAT CSLM 2500
    Drum Capacity 2.2 m³ 2.5 m³
    Drum Slewing Degree NA NA
    Drum Rotation Speed 0 to 22 rpm 0 to 22 rpm
    Bucket Capacity 450 L 420 L
    Fuel Tank 80 L 100 L
    Water Tank Capacity 580 L 500 L
    Water Pump Capacity 275 L/min 230 L/min
    Weight Unladen** 6300 Kg 6500 kg
    Weighing Technology Electronic hydraulic pressure Presser Transducer

    Dimensions

    Tarle SLM 2200 CONMAT CSLM 2500
    Overall Length 5800 mm 5665 mm
    Overall Width 2225 mm 2420 mm
    Overall Height 4470 mm 3670 mm
    Tyres 405-70-20 MT54 14PR HD 12.5 / 80x18, 16 PR
    Ground Clearance 340 mm 330 mm
